Recently, Neutrosophy theory and its application in decision-making has became in a significant issue for the scientific community. In this paper, an extension of the PESTEL (Political, Economic, Social, Technological, Ecological and Legal) tech-nique adapted to the neutrosophic environment is proposed for decision making in management. The proposal is specially tailored for the dynamic analysis of the different factors in an uncertain environment. The framework developed for the extension of the PESTEL technique to the neutrosophic environment is compound for six fundamental activities. A system of recommendation is designed for practical purposes. A case study is developed for the use of the neutrosophic PESTEL to show the applicability of the technique. The paper ends with conclusions and recommendations for future work.
